| Diagnosis: | LEUKONYCHIA | Category: | clinical sign / environmental injury / nail disorders | ||
| Body Site: | nail, hand | Age: | 33 years | ||
| Contributor: | Jerzy Pawlak, MSc,PhD | ||||
| Description: | transverse white lines and white macules | ||||
| Comments: | This 33-year-old man has a history of recurrent trauma to his nails resulting in transverst white lines. | ||||

| Diagnosis: | LEUKONYCHIA / TRAUMA | Category: | environmental injury | ||
| Body Site: | nail, hand | Age: | 15 years | ||
| Contributor: | Bernard Cohen, MD | ||||
| Description: | multiple parallel transverse white lines | ||||
| Comments: | This healthy adolescent developed transverse white lines on his fingernails. He confessed to habitually pushing at his cuticles with his nails. | ||||

| Diagnosis: | LEUKONYCHIA | Category: | nail disorders / environmental injury | ||
| Body Site: | nail, hand | Age: | 9 years | ||
| Contributor: | Bernard Cohen, MD | ||||
| Description: | narrow transverse white macules | ||||
| Comments: | This healthy 9-year-old boy was evaluated for linear white macules on his finger nails. The toe nails were spared. He did confess to habitually picking at his nails near the cuticles. | ||||

| Diagnosis: | LEUKONYCHIA | Category: | nail disorders / normal variants / genodermatosis/genetic disorder | ||
| Body Site: | nail, all | Age: | 10 years | ||
| Contributor: | Bernard Cohen, MD | ||||
| Description: | white nail plates | ||||
| Comments: | This healthy boy developed white nail 2 years earlier. His nails were otherwise normal, and he had no history of renal, hepatic, or pulmonary disease. The family history was negative for similar nail changes. | ||||
